Yinhe J-1 is a specialized 1-ply Ayous wood table tennis blade, distinguished by its substantial 10mm thickness. This unique construction provides a distinct playing experience, offering a soft touch and considerable dwell time for spin-oriented play, while also generating significant power on harder strokes. It is well-suited for players who appreciate a blade with a lot of feel, particularly in the short game, and who can leverage its power for aggressive attacks. The blade's substantial weight and thickness contribute to a powerful presence on the table, making it a distinctive choice for those seeking a blend of control and offensive capability.

1-Ply Construction

J-1 features a minimalist construction of a single, thick ply of Ayous wood. This pure wood design is responsible for its unique playing characteristics, offering a distinct feel and dwell time that differs significantly from multi-ply composite blades.

Speed
8.0

Yinhe J-1 presents a dichotomy in speed. It feels slow or even defensive during passive play, blocks, and pushes, but can generate surprising attacking speed and power when struck with full force. This variation is a signature characteristic of its thick, single-ply wood construction.

Control
7.5

Despite its power potential and thickness, J-1 is highly regarded for its control, especially in the short game. The soft feel and ample dwell time allow for precise placement and delicate touch, making it highly controllable for strategic rallies and placement-oriented play.

Feel
Medium-Soft
SoftMedium-SoftHard

J-1 delivers a consistently soft feel, particularly noticeable in lighter touches and short game interactions. This softness comes from the single-ply Ayous wood, which allows for significant ball compression and a pronounced feeling of the ball sinking into the blade.

Throw Angle
Medium-High
LowMedium-HighHigh

J-1 generally produces a medium-high throw angle, especially when paired with complementary rubbers. This allows for a good arc on loops, making it effective for both attacking play and controlled, spin-oriented rallies.

Dwell Time
8.0

The considerable thickness and single-ply Ayous wood construction contribute to an extended dwell time. This allows players to impart significant spin and provides a forgiving, controlled feel during strokes.

Flexibility
8.0

Despite its thickness, J-1 possesses a notable degree of flexibility, especially when engaged with harder strokes. This flexibility, combined with the soft wood, allows the blade to 'spring' the ball, adding extra energy and spin to powerful shots.

Vibration
7.0

The thick, single-ply construction results in noticeable vibration feedback. Some players find this feedback enhances the blade's feel and connection to the ball, while others may perceive it as pronounced, especially on harder hits. It's a distinct, characteristic vibration, not a jarring one.

Quality
7.0

Yinhe produces high-quality blades at competitive prices, and the J-1 is a prime example. It is generally considered well-constructed with a finish that feels more premium than its price suggests. The treated Ayous wood contributes to a solid, durable feel in hand.

Technology

Yinhe J-1 embodies a purist approach to blade design, relying solely on the inherent qualities of a single, thick ply of Ayous wood. This construction eschews modern composites, focusing on maximizing the wood's natural properties. Ayous wood is chosen for its unique combination of softness, elasticity, and power potential. The substantial 10mm thickness is central to the blade's performance, enabling significant ball dwell and energy transfer while defining its distinctive feel and weight. It represents a traditional construction philosophy tailored for the modern game.

Similar Blades

Single-ply Hinoki Blades (e.g., Nittaku Acoustic, Tibhar Samsonov Force Pro Black)

For players seeking a similar feel and power profile, single-ply Hinoki blades are often suggested as alternatives. Hinoki is a premium wood known for its excellent feel, dwell, and power in single-ply constructions. However, these blades typically come at a significantly higher price point than the Yinhe J-1.
